    Abstract: There is provided a method of reducing traffic on a data network. The method includes (i) reading an indicator of whether a last attempted communication with a network device was successful, and (ii) performing discovery of the network device at each time specified by a first schedule in response to the indicator indicating that the last attempted communication with the network device was successful, and at each time specified by a second schedule in response to the indicator indicating that the last attempted communication with the network device was not successful. There is also provided a system that performs the method, and a storage device that contains a program that controls a processor to perform the method.

    Abstract: There is provided a method that includes (a) including in a dataset, data indicative of a time, (b) executing a hash function on the dataset to yield a hash value, and (c) employing the hash value as a password for a user to access a device. There is also provided a method that includes (a) including in a dataset, data indicative of a time, (b) executing a hash function on the dataset to yield a hash value, (c) determining that the hash value matches a password from a user, and (d) granting to the user, access to a device. There are also provided systems that perform the methods and storage devices that contain instructions for causing processors to perform the methods.

    Abstract: Technologies are described herein for parameter optimization of at least one interlayer handover in a multilayer wireless cellular communication network. Performance information for the communication network is retrieved. The retrieved performance information for the communication network is then averaged over a predetermined period of time. A determination is made based on the performance information as to whether optimization of the communication network is required. If so, the interlayer handover is optimized by capturing a current set of configuration parameters for the interlayer handover, generating a new set of configuration parameters for the interlayer handover based on the retrieved performance information and the current set of configuration parameters, and applying the new set of configuration parameters to the communication network.

    Abstract: A service based Ringback Tone service that may be personalized by a calling party instead of a called party. The calling party generates and stores an originating profile that contains Ringback Tones or Ringback messages associated with a Ringback Tone subscriber (called party). When the calling party contacts the called party, the Ringback Tone chosen by the calling party and associated with the called party is then sent to the calling party until the calling party answers the call.

    Abstract: A mobile communication network includes an antenna site shared by two or more telecommunications service providers. The antenna site includes a shared resource, such as an antenna, telecommunications equipment, or bandwidth, used by multiple service providers and connects to multiple signal processing centers, each of which belongs to one of the service providers. The signal processing centers may provide modulating signals to the antenna site to use in modulating a carrier. The antenna site may also direct received signals from mobile terminals to the signal processing center for the appropriate service provider. A billing module at the antenna site maintains an accounting of resources used by each service provider.

    Abstract: A channel response may be estimated from training symbols that are received over a channel, by determining an initial channel estimate from the training symbols and applying bias to the initial channel estimate to obtain a biased channel estimate. The biased channel estimate may then be used to demodulate a signal that is received over the channel.

    Abstract: A received information signal is decoded to obtain the received information and to produce at least one feature of the received information signal. The received information signal is preliminarily classified as containing a normal burst or a truncated burst based upon the at least one feature, to obtain a preliminary classification. Cyclic redundancy checking of the received information that is decoded is performed. The received information signal is then further classified as containing a normal burst or a truncated burst based upon the preliminary classification and whether the cyclic redundancy checking is valid, to obtain a further classification. The received information signal may be still further classified as containing a normal burst or a truncated burst based upon the further classification and at least one transition rule for normal bursts and truncated bursts between the received information signal and a previously received information signal.
